The Dwyer M200 Manometer is a precision inclined tube instrument designed for accurate measurement of low air and gas pressures in a wide range of industrial and laboratory applications. With a measurement range of 0.05 to 2.00 inches of water column (in WC), this manometer offers reliable performance for tasks such as HVAC system balancing, clean room pressure validation, air flow monitoring, and filter performance testing.
Engineered for durability and clarity, the Dwyer M200 features a solid, clear acrylic body that resists breakage, warping, and chemical damage. This rugged design ensures long-term reliability in both stationary and field applications. The inclined tube, filled with a specially formulated red gauge oil, provides enhanced resolution and sensitivity, allowing for precise detection of even slight pressure variations.
The manometer includes a parallax-free reflective scale behind the fluid column, which eliminates reading errors and improves measurement accuracy. A built-in ground glass bubble level is integrated into the design to ensure proper leveling during setup, contributing to consistently accurate readings. Its compact size and mounting hardware allow for flexible installation on walls, panels, or portable setups.
